CBRE
Real Estate
CRE lending hits 5-year high — global investment volume up 18% YoY in Q1 2026

CBRE's Lending Momentum Index reached a five-year high. Multifamily debt remains abundant, industrial is supply-constrained, and prime office scarcity intensifies across gateway markets. $562B projected for full-year 2026.

May 2026 · CBRE Research
JLL
Real Estate
Industrial & logistics vacancy tightens to record lows across Sun Belt markets

Atlanta, Dallas, and Phoenix lead Sun Belt industrial absorption. E-commerce demand continues to drive net absorption above completions. Rent growth of 12–18% projected in prime industrial corridors through 2027.

May 2026 · JLL Research
WSJ
Real Estate
Multifamily demand surges as homeownership affordability hits 40-year low

With mortgage rates elevated and home prices near historic highs, rental demand continues to surge. Class A multifamily assets in growth markets are seeing sub-4% vacancy rates and strong rent escalations.

May 2026 · Wall Street Journal
PitchBook
Private Equity
Global PE dry powder reaches $4.1T — managers under pressure to deploy capital

Record levels of uncalled capital are forcing PE managers to compete harder for quality deals. Smaller, focused funds with sector expertise continue to outperform megafunds on a risk-adjusted basis.

May 2026 · PitchBook
Bloomberg
Private Equity
AI infrastructure and energy transition emerge as top PE themes for 2026–2028

Private equity firms are pivoting aggressively toward data center infrastructure, power generation, and AI-adjacent businesses. Deal multiples in these sectors are commanding 15–22x EBITDA with strong conviction from institutional LPs.

May 2026 · Bloomberg
WSJ
Private Equity
Secondary market for PE stakes hits record $145B — liquidity solutions in high demand

The PE secondary market hit a record $145B in 2025 as LPs sought liquidity and GPs extended hold periods. GP-led continuation vehicles now account for over 40% of secondary volume, reshaping how private capital changes hands.
